What Is a Car Locksmith?
A car locksmith, likewise understood as an automotive locksmith, is a specific professional trained to deal with all kinds of problems related to vehicle locks and keys. These experts can assist with a range of services, from key duplication and lock rekeying to transponder key programming and ignition repair. Car locksmith professionals are equipped with the tools and understanding to manage modern car security systems, consisting of those with advanced technology like keyless entry and anti-theft devices.
Why You Might Need a Car Locksmith
There are a number of scenarios where the services of a car locksmith might be essential:
Lockout: If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can rapidly and efficiently open your vehicle without triggering damage.Key Duplication: If you need an extra set of keys or your existing keys are worn out, a car locksmith can make high-quality duplicates.Transponder Key Programming: Modern lorries typically feature transponder keys that need programming to match the car's special recognition code. An expert locksmith can handle this job.Lock Repair or Replacement: If your car lock is broken or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it.Ignition Repair: Issues with the ignition can avoid your car from beginning. When you call a car locksmith, the procedure generally involves the following actions:
Initial Contact:
Call or Book Online: Contact the locksmith through their telephone number or site. Offer them with your location and the nature of the issue.Estimate: Most locksmith professionals will give you an estimate over the phone. Guarantee you comprehend the cost before they get here.
On-Site Service:
Verification: The locksmith will request recognition to verify that you are the owner of the vehicle. This is a basic security measure.Evaluation: They will examine the issue and determine the very best strategy.Service Execution: Depending on the issue, the locksmith might unlock your Car Locksmiths Near Me, make a brand-new key, rekey your locks, or perform other required jobs.Testing: After the service is finished, the locksmith will check the locks and keys to guarantee whatever is working correctly.Payment: Payment is typically made at the end of the service. Q: How much does a car locksmith usually cost?A: The cost of a car locksmith service can differ based on the specific job, the make and design of your car, and the area. Normally, opening a car can range from ₤ 30 to ₤ 100, while making a new key can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150. More complicated jobs like transponder key programming or lock replacement can be more costly.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a new key without the initial?A: Yes, a professional car locksmith can make a brand-new key even if you do not have the original. However, this procedure may require extra time and tools, and it can be more expensive than duplicating an existing key.
Q: Are car locksmiths legal?A: Yes, car locksmith professionals are legal, however they must be accredited and bonded in a lot of states. They are also needed to confirm the identity of the vehicle owner to prevent theft or unapproved gain access to.
Q: How long does it take for a car locksmith to arrive?A: The action time can differ. In metropolitan areas, it may take 30 minutes to an hour. In more remote areas, the wait time can be longer. Numerous locksmiths use 24/7 emergency situation services.
Q: Can a car locksmith program a transponder key?A: Yes, car locksmith professionals who are trained in contemporary automotive innovation can program transponder keys. This involves syncing the key's distinct code with your car's onboard computer system.
Q: Do car locksmiths offer mobile services?A: Yes, numerous car locksmith professionals offer mobile services, enabling them to come to your location, whether it's your home, office, or the side of the roadway.

Car locksmith professionals utilize a variety of tools and technologies to perform their services:
Lock Picks and Decoders: For standard lockout support and lock manipulation.Key Cutting Machines: To replicate keys precisely.Transponder Key Programmers: To program transponder keys to your car's specific code.Diagnostic Scanners: To recognize concerns with your car's electronic systems.Drilling Equipment: For scenarios where locks are significantly damaged and require to be drilled out.
